Gunpowder becomes wet in water : limits water camping

Postby scarfacemperor » Wed Oct 03, 2012 6:28 pm

Hello, if you think that water camping is boring, I have a realistic suggestion :

When you stay in water, the gunpowder of your ammo becomes wet, making it less powerful.

The longer you stay in water, the more your gunpowder is wet. Wet gunpowder is less powerful than dry one : you lose 5% firepower every 6 seconds spend in water, until -50% is lost (1 minute in water). After 1 minute, your weapon doesn't go under 50% of firepower. So, camping very long in water will make your weapon cause 50% of its normal damage.

If you exit water, your gunpowder regains efficiency, +10% every 3 seconds, until it recovers 100% power


That would not affect you in a signifiant way if you just cross a small distance on water (power loss depends on how long you stay in water), however if you want to swim to the other side of the map, to camp near enemies and make loose kills, that will strongly decrease your weapon's efficiency.

The weaker damage inflicted when you stay long in damage will be another data to consider to go from A to B. It will probably make bridges a more strategical point.

+ limit water camping in a realistic way
+ more intense fight on land
+ we can expect bridges to become more strategical
- will weaken attack in some maps
